#e4312d h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#e4312d is composed of 89.4% red, 19.2%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 78.5% magenta, 80.3%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 1.3 degrees, a saturation of 77.2% and a lightness of 53.5%. #e4312d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ff625a with #c90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

● #e4312d color description : Bright red.
The hexadecimal color #e4312d has RGB values of R:228, G:49, B:45 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.79, Y:0.8,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14954797.
